048
049 package org.jfree.chart.axis;
050
051 import java.awt.geom.Rectangle2D;
052 import java.io.Serializable;
053
054 import org.jfree.ui.RectangleEdge;
055 import org.jfree.util.PublicCloneable;
056
057 /**
058 * A record that contains the space required at each edge of a plot.
059 */
060 public class AxisSpace implements Cloneable, PublicCloneable, Serializable {
061
062 /** For serialization. */
063 private static final long serialVersionUID = -2490732595134766305L;
064
065 /** The top space. */
066 private double top;
067
068 /** The bottom space. */
069 private double bottom;
070
071 /** The left space. */
072 private double left;
073
074 /** The right space. */
075 private double right;
076
077 /**
078 * Creates a new axis space record.
079 */
080 public AxisSpace() {
081 this.top = 0.0;
082 this.bottom = 0.0;
083 this.left = 0.0;
084 this.right = 0.0;
085 }
086
087 /**
088 * Returns the space reserved for axes at the top of the plot area.
089 *
090 * @return The space (in Java2D units).
091 */
092 public double getTop() {
093 return this.top;
094 }
095
096 /**
097 * Sets the space reserved for axes at the top of the plot area.
098 *
099 * @param space the space (in Java2D units).
100 */
101 public void setTop(double space) {
102 this.top = space;
103 }
104
105 /**
106 * Returns the space reserved for axes at the bottom of the plot area.
107 *
108 * @return The space (in Java2D units).
109 */
110 public double getBottom() {
111 return this.bottom;
112 }
113
114 /**
115 * Sets the space reserved for axes at the bottom of the plot area.
116 *
117 * @param space the space (in Java2D units).
118 */
119 public void setBottom(double space) {
120 this.bottom = space;
121 }
122
123 /**
124 * Returns the space reserved for axes at the left of the plot area.
125 *
126 * @return The space (in Java2D units).
127 */
128 public double getLeft() {
129 return this.left;
130 }
131
132 /**
133 * Sets the space reserved for axes at the left of the plot area.
134 *
135 * @param space the space (in Java2D units).
136 */
137 public void setLeft(double space) {
138 this.left = space;
139 }
140
141 /**
142 * Returns the space reserved for axes at the right of the plot area.
143 *
144 * @return The space (in Java2D units).
145 */
146 public double getRight() {
147 return this.right;
148 }
149
150 /**
151 * Sets the space reserved for axes at the right of the plot area.
152 *
153 * @param space the space (in Java2D units).
154 */
155 public void setRight(double space) {
156 this.right = space;
157 }
158
159 /**
160 * Adds space to the top, bottom, left or right edge of the plot area.
161 *
162 * @param space the space (in Java2D units).
163 * @param edge the edge (<code>null</code> not permitted).
164 */
165 public void add(double space, RectangleEdge edge) {
166 if (edge == null) {
167 throw new IllegalArgumentException("Null 'edge' argument.");
168 }
169 if (edge == RectangleEdge.TOP) {
170 this.top += space;
171 }
172 else if (edge == RectangleEdge.BOTTOM) {
173 this.bottom += space;
174 }
175 else if (edge == RectangleEdge.LEFT) {
176 this.left += space;
177 }
178 else if (edge == RectangleEdge.RIGHT) {
179 this.right += space;
180 }
181 else {
182 throw new IllegalStateException("Unrecognised 'edge' argument.");
183 }
184 }
185
186 /**
187 * Ensures that this object reserves at least as much space as another.
188 *
189 * @param space the other space.
190 */
191 public void ensureAtLeast(AxisSpace space) {
192 this.top = Math.max(this.top, space.top);
193 this.bottom = Math.max(this.bottom, space.bottom);
194 this.left = Math.max(this.left, space.left);
195 this.right = Math.max(this.right, space.right);
196 }
197
198 /**
199 * Ensures there is a minimum amount of space at the edge corresponding to
200 * the specified axis location.
201 *
202 * @param space the space.
203 * @param edge the location.
204 */
205 public void ensureAtLeast(double space, RectangleEdge edge) {
206 if (edge == RectangleEdge.TOP) {
207 if (this.top < space) {
208 this.top = space;
209 }
210 }
211 else if (edge == RectangleEdge.BOTTOM) {
212 if (this.bottom < space) {
213 this.bottom = space;
214 }
215 }
216 else if (edge == RectangleEdge.LEFT) {
217 if (this.left < space) {
218 this.left = space;
219 }
220 }
221 else if (edge == RectangleEdge.RIGHT) {
222 if (this.right < space) {
223 this.right = space;
224 }
225 }
226 else {
227 throw new IllegalStateException(
228 "AxisSpace.ensureAtLeast(): unrecognised AxisLocation."
229 );
230 }
231 }
232
233 /**
234 * Shrinks an area by the space attributes.
235 *
236 * @param area the area to shrink.
237 * @param result an optional carrier for the result.
238 *
239 * @return The result.
240 */
241 public Rectangle2D shrink(Rectangle2D area, Rectangle2D result) {
242 if (result == null) {
243 result = new Rectangle2D.Double();
244 }
245 result.setRect(
246 area.getX() + this.left,
247 area.getY() + this.top,
248 area.getWidth() - this.left - this.right,
249 area.getHeight() - this.top - this.bottom
250 );
251 return result;
252 }
253
254 /**
255 * Expands an area by the amount of space represented by this object.
256 *
257 * @param area the area to expand.
258 * @param result an optional carrier for the result.
259 *
260 * @return The result.
261 */
262 public Rectangle2D expand(Rectangle2D area, Rectangle2D result) {
263 if (result == null) {
264 result = new Rectangle2D.Double();
265 }
266 result.setRect(
267 area.getX() - this.left,
268 area.getY() - this.top,
269 area.getWidth() + this.left + this.right,
270 area.getHeight() + this.top + this.bottom
271 );
272 return result;
273 }
274
275 /**
276 * Calculates the reserved area.
277 *
278 * @param area the area.
279 * @param edge the edge.
280 *
281 * @return The reserved area.
282 */
283 public Rectangle2D reserved(Rectangle2D area, RectangleEdge edge) {
284 Rectangle2D result = null;
285 if (edge == RectangleEdge.TOP) {
286 result = new Rectangle2D.Double(
287 area.getX(), area.getY(), area.getWidth(), this.top
288 );
289 }
290 else if (edge == RectangleEdge.BOTTOM) {
291 result = new Rectangle2D.Double(
292 area.getX(), area.getMaxY() - this.top,
293 area.getWidth(), this.bottom
294 );
295 }
296 else if (edge == RectangleEdge.LEFT) {
297 result = new Rectangle2D.Double(
298 area.getX(), area.getY(), this.left, area.getHeight()
299 );
300 }
301 else if (edge == RectangleEdge.RIGHT) {
302 result = new Rectangle2D.Double(
303 area.getMaxX() - this.right, area.getY(),
304 this.right, area.getHeight()
305 );
306 }
307 return result;
308 }
309
310 /**
311 * Returns a clone of the object.
312 *
313 * @return A clone.
314 *
315 * @throws CloneNotSupportedException This class won't throw this exception,
316 * but subclasses (if any) might.
317 */
318 public Object clone() throws CloneNotSupportedException {
319 return super.clone();
320 }
321
322 /**
323 * Tests this object for equality with another object.
324 *
325 * @param obj the object to compare against.
326 *
327 * @return <code>true</code> or <code>false</code>.
328 */
329 public boolean equals(Object obj) {
330 if (obj == this) {
331 return true;
332 }
333 if (!(obj instanceof AxisSpace)) {
334 return false;
335 }
336 AxisSpace that = (AxisSpace) obj;
337 if (this.top != that.top) {
338 return false;
339 }
340 if (this.bottom != that.bottom) {
341 return false;
342 }
343 if (this.left != that.left) {
344 return false;
345 }
346 if (this.right != that.right) {
347 return false;
348 }
349 return true;
350 }
351
352 /**
353 * Returns a hash code for this object.
354 *
355 * @return A hash code.
356 */
357 public int hashCode() {
358 int result = 23;
359 long l = Double.doubleToLongBits(this.top);
360 result = 37 * result + (int) (l ^ (l >>> 32));
361 l = Double.doubleToLongBits(this.bottom);
362 result = 37 * result + (int) (l ^ (l >>> 32));
363 l = Double.doubleToLongBits(this.left);
364 result = 37 * result + (int) (l ^ (l >>> 32));
365 l = Double.doubleToLongBits(this.right);
366 result = 37 * result + (int) (l ^ (l >>> 32));
367 return result;
368 }
369
370 /**
371 * Returns a string representing the object (for debugging purposes).
372 *
373 * @return A string.
374 */
375 public String toString() {
376 return super.toString() + "[left=" + this.left + ",right=" + this.right
377 + ",top=" + this.top + ",bottom=" + this.bottom + "]";
378 }
379
380 }
